About the Target
This antibody is suited for researchers who want to evaluate KCND3 and relate it to cell-state biology. KCND3 is a channel or transporter associated with regulated flux across cellular membranes. Its behavior can reflect changes in differentiation state, stress, or remodeling of cellular architecture.
Monitoring KCND3 alongside context markers can improve interpretation when phenotypes are subtle.
Research Context
Transport targets are commonly studied under stimulation conditions that alter membrane potential, osmolarity, or nutrient availability. Because regulation can be multi-layered, combining abundance and localization information can sharpen conclusions.
Consider these angles when interpreting target-level changes:
- stimulus-dependent trafficking and turnover
- patterns consistent with apical or basolateral sorting
- surface versus intracellular pool distribution
